About The Role

Our Vision - We believe that with a great education, every neurodivergent pupil can thrive and make their way in the world.

The purpose of the Pastoral Support Worker is to work alongside teaching staff, parents/ carers and pupils; providing a 1:1 mentoring and/or tutoring role to specific pupils. The underpinning value of the work is to ensure that every pupil achieves their potential through the provision of targeted support and intervention, working with the school’s Senior Leadership Team.

Under the direction of the Senior Leadership Team, the Pastoral Support Worker will contribute to all aspects of pupils’ well-being and achievement. The role will involve a mixture of dealing with parents/ carers, intervention groups, supporting learning in addition to managing pupils’ behavioural and attendance challenges. This will involve writing Support Plans and intervening with difficulties around the school in terms of pastoral support.

General Responsibilities As Pastoral Support.

The post holder will:

  • Safeguard and promote the welfare of pupils and young people
  • Liaise with the Senior Leadership Team to ensure pupils who are identified as being in need of support receive appropriate help.
  • Assisting and supporting pupils during learning sessions, break time and lunchtimes, this will involve; managing pupil behaviour, lunchtime activities and rewards etc.
  • Take part in any relevant meetings to assist with pupil welfare e.g. review meetings with parents/carers and external agencies.
  • Management of rewards and sanctions for pupils: suitable and consistent interventions put into place as needed.

About Us

New Barn School offers a broad, balanced and relevant curriculum to boys and girls, aged 6–19 years who have Social, Emotional and Mental Health complexities.

New Barn School takes full advantage of its beautiful settings and fosters a love for using the outdoor curriculum including forest school, farm experiences and horse riding. The school is within a commutable distance of Swindon, Oxford, Andover, Basingstoke and Reading and other surrounding towns and villages.

Our services offer a stable, secure and supportive environment, in which the pupils and young people we care for can develop the skills and confidence necessary to help them fulfil their potential.
